Delta employees in Nashville are stepping up to do their part this Sunday and participating in Music City Keep on Playin’ – A Benefit for Flood Relief. This is the first national live concert and telethon to support flood relief efforts.
Delta’s Nashville employees will join other volunteers in staffing a phone bank accepting donations during a live three-hour broadcast on Great American Country Television (GACTV). Organized by GACTV, the Nashville Convention & Visitors Bureau and Gaylord Entertainment the event will include performances from some big names in country music, including Keith Urban, Martina McBride, Brad Paisley, Lady Antebellum and many more.

All money raised will go to the Community Foundation of Middle Tennessee, the organization distributing the donations to middle Tennesseans in need.
